What ICD 9 codes should I use for this report?

Date of Consultation
8/2/15
Reason for Consultation
A 12.5 week intrauterine pregnancy and right arm abscess positive MRSA.

History of Present Illness
A 31 year old gravida 4, para 2-0-1-2, with unknown last menstrual period presenting at 12.5 weeks dated by an 11-week ultrasound performed here at ABC Hospital on 7/26/15. The patient is being readmitted for continued IV antibiotic treatment for right arm abscess secondary to IV drug use. This abscess tested positive for MRSA during the above noted admission. The patient was recently admitted on 7/26/15 and left against medical advice on 8/1/15. She returned a day later to resume treatment. She is status post I&D of this right arm abscess on 7/26/15. The patient has been restarted on IV daptomycin per infectious disease and the plan is for 2 weeks of IV antibiotics. OB is consulted due to pregnancy. The patient denies abdominal pain, cramping, leakage of fluid or vaginal bleeding. The patient does report that she has another yeast infection secondary to antibiotics as she has experienced in the past after antibiotic use. The patient has not initiated prenatal care to date. She is contemplating termination of pregnancy.

All histories & Exam have been recorded

Diagnostic Impression
1. A 12.5 week intrauterine pregnancy
2. IV drug abuse.
3. Meth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us bacteremia and wound culture.
4. Yeast infection
 
647.83, 648.33, 648.93, 646.63, 304.90, 112.1, 790.7, 682.3, 041.12, V23.7, e930.9

(You will need to arrange in the order that pertains to visit; if an ultrasound was done on this visit, may also add 88.78)

**also, if the patient presents with other symptoms that would support a dx of sepsis, I would query the physician for clarification since the patient presented with bacteremia**
